Method for filtering guidance moment signal in electromechanical steering system of motor car, involves adjusting parameters of filter dependent on oscillation and driving conditions if parasitic oscillation is incorporated in signal

The method involves determining part of a reference value signal i.e. guidance moment signal (LMR), as a value signal is filtered by a filter (5) e.g. low-pass filter. A determination is made to check whether parasitic oscillation is incorporated in the value signal by a parasitic oscillation determination unit (2). A driving condition (F) is determined by a driving condition determination unit (3). Parameters e.g. central frequency, of the filter are adjusted by a parameterization unit (4) dependent on the oscillation and the condition if the oscillation is incorporated in the value signal. The driving condition comprises a state quantity vector with state vehicle velocity.
